Description
Directory traversal vulnerability in SafeNet Authentication Service (SAS) Outlook Web Access Agent (formerly CRYPTOCard) before 1.03.30109 all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) in the GetFile parameter to owa/owa.

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Safenet-Inc | Safenet Authentication Service Outlook Web Access Agent | <= 1.03.20212 |
